Android学习笔记(五):AndroidDebug
本篇笔记主要介绍一下Android中的记录日志的方法,以方便在代码中调错和处理异常。
Android中的Debug调错和记录日志的方法和工具也是很强大的,我们还以通过DDMS(Dalvik Debug Monitor Service)来模拟打电话和发短信功能。
下面通过在前几篇完成的BMI项目中加入记录日志的代码来演示下Android的Debug功能。
编程步骤:
1.修改BMI.java,在其中加入一些记录日志的代码。
2.在strings.xml中定义增加的字串
<string name="error_msg">程序运行异常,请重新启动...</string>
代码修改到此就完成了,那么如何来查看日志的输出呢。
3.在myeclipse中切换视图,打开DDMS视图。windows--Open Perspective--DDMS(如果没有,在other中找)

4.在视图下方的LogCat窗口中就可以看到程序运行时的日志输出,并且可以通过增加过滤器的方式来过滤不需要的信息。
主要知识点:
a.在修改BMI.java时,我们用到了Log.d(...)和Log.e(...)这样的方法。在Android中,日志的纪录有5个级别,分别是:
① Log.v(VERBOSE)详细信息 ② Log.d(DEBUG) 调错信息 ③ Log.i(INFO)通知信息 ④ Log.w(WARN)警告信息 ⑤ Log.e(ERROR)错误信息
b.在BMI.java中定义的TAG属性,这个属性是一个标签,用来区分其他的日志信息。
本文介绍了Android中的日志记录方法及使用技巧,包括不同级别的日志类型及其应用场景,并通过BMI项目示例展示了如何在实际应用中加入日志记录代码。
:AndroidDebug&spm=1001.2101.3001.5002&articleId=6002561&d=1&t=3&u=7b00c079b0fa43ff812dc125275c96a4)
582

被折叠的 条评论
为什么被折叠?



